Chilton expects to stay with Marussia

Marussia F1 Team Max Chilton says he expects to remain with Marussia for a second season in 2014. Chilton made his debut for the team in Australia and recorded a best finish of 14th place in Monaco. Marussia has already confirmed that current driver Jules Bianchi will continue with the team into 2014. 'I came into Formula One and was ready, but it definitely takes time to really get it,' Chilton told The Official F1 website. 'Since the [summer] break I’ve felt a lot more comfortable, and also the car has been more balanced so I’ve been able to show more of my potential.
